How do I stop my texts from going to my email?

To disable this feature:
  1. On the phone, open the Email application.
  2. Tap Settings, then tap Microsoft Exchange ActiveSync in the Accounts group.
  3. Next, tap Settings under Common settings group, then tap your email address.
  4. Scroll down and under the Server settings group, uncheck Sync SMS.

Why are my iPhone text messages going to my email?

It sounds like your Apple ID is activated with iMessage and your “Start new conversations from” is set to your email address, instead of your phone number. To resolve this, simply navigate to Settings > Messages > Send & Receive and configure the settings to start new conversations from your phone number.

How do I get my iMessage to show my number instead of my email?

Go to your iPhone’s settings. Go to your phone’s iMessage section, then tap on the Send and Receive section. Simply click on the option which shows the New Conversation From. Tap the phone number instead of showing the email.
